Pelasgian Man

This man represents a culture known as the Pelasgians, who were said to be the aboriginal inhabitants of Greece prior to the arrival of the Achaeans (aka the Hellenes or ethnic Greeks). In Priestess of the Lost Colony, they are portrayed as a population of dark-skinned, blue-eyed hunter-gatherers who manufacture silver jewelry, paint artwork in caves, and erect megalithic tombs for their dead chieftains.
